Dee Why, 2099 demographic data
The median household income for Dee Why is $2,106, 1% higher than Greater Sydney's household income of $2,077. Dee Why has a younger age profile compared to the rest of Greater Sydney (median age 36 vs 37). Property ownership data shows 57% of property owners in Dee Why have a mortgage.
